Installing graphics drivers Ubuntu 13.10(Hybrid Graphics).


If you have hybrid graphics then you don’t have to  turn off the discrete graphic card manually  any more. Ubuntu 13.10 supports hybrid graphics.


AMD Hybrid Graphics : 

I've tested this and it works fine. According to the Ubuntu wiki page there aren't any known issues yet. 
To get proper AMD Hybrid graphics support in Ubuntu 13.10 all you have to do is install the latest fglrx driver and fglrx-pxpress from the repositories.

sudo apt-get install fglrx fglrx-pxpress

with AMD graphics you can switch between the two graphic cards by AMD catalyst control center like you do in Windows. But it requires a system reboot for changes to take effect. Other than that everything is fine. No ever heating.
